For the first time, physicists have been able to measure the geometrical 'shape' a lone electron adopts as it moves through a solid. It's an achievement that will unlock a whole new way of studying how crystalline solids behave on a quantum level.The research was led by physicists Mingu Kang – formerly of MIT and now at Cornell University – and Sunjie Kim of Seoul National University.

To describe the wave aspect of electrons, physicists use wave functions: mathematical models that describe the properties of the wave as evolving possibilities of finding the particle in a specific place with specific features.
